First and foremost, always use a strong password. This means a mix of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ters. Avoid easily guessed passwords like “123456” or “password.” Instead, consider something like “M3g@C@s1n0$ecure!”—not only is it memorable, but it’s also significantly harder to crack. In fact, according to cybersecurity experts, a password of at least 12 characters can take years to crack with brute force methods.

What Are the Best Practices for Account Security?

Practising good security habits can significantly reduce your risk of falling victim to cyber threats. Here are some essential steps to consider:

  • Enable two-factor authentication (2FA): This adds an extra layer of security by requiring a second verification step, usually via SMS or an app.
  • Regularly update your password: Change it at least every six months, or sooner if you suspect any suspicious activity.
  • Monitor your account activity: Check your transaction history regularly to spot any unauthorised transactions.

How Do You Recognise Phishing Attempts?

Phishing is a common method used by cybercriminals to gain access to your personal information. It typically involves fraudulent emails or messages that appear to be from a legitimate source, like Mega Casino. Here’s how to spot them:

  • Check the sender’s email address: Often, phishing emails come from addresses that look similar but have slight variations.
  • Look for spelling and grammatical errors: Legitimate communications rarely contain mistakes.
  • Avoid clicking on links: Instead, navigate to the site directly through your browser.

Is It Worth It to Use a VPN for Added Security?

Using a VPN (Virtual Private Network) can add another layer of security when accessing Mega Casino. It encrypts your internet connection, making it harder for anyone to intercept your data. While it may seem like an unnecessary step for casual users, it can be beneficial, especially if you’re using public Wi-Fi. However, keep in mind that not all VPNs are created equal—choose a reputable provider to ensure your data is protected.
